If I make no mistake, Forty licks was officially released in China (PRC) with only 36 songs, Brown Sugar, Honky Tonk Women, Beast of Burden and Let's Spend the Night Together being skipped.
These songs also weren't performend by the Stones when they played Shanghai
The official release is a double CD, and there's a counterfeit 2 single CDs version.
Can someone confirm ?

Then I found on the net a chinese relase of Live Licks, missing Paint It Black but including Brown Sugar, Honky Tonk Women, and Beast of Burden, which does not seem logical to me. Is this a counterfeit ?

I have 3 variations of the chinese 40 Licks, can´t really say if one is pirated or not.
One is two CD:s in a single jewelcase and slipcase,
One is 2 separate CD:s in 2 slipcases (VOL 1 and 2 )
and finally, 2 individual CD:s without slipcases (VOL 1 and 2).

I also got ABB, wich looks legit, it only´has 12 tracks on it, so it´s censored.
I did not see Live Licks in Beijing when I was there last year. But I got a chinese Four Flicks, a chinese SARS-concert, and one claiming to be ABB, altough it got an additional disc with with mixed songs, all housed in a wooden box, and the spelling is funny, clearly a non legit release.

I've got another version of Forty Licks that isn't mentioned. It's a 3-cd release in a thicker than usual jewelcase wrapped in a double cardbox.
In addition to the regular two cd's, there is a third one with 20 songs on.
This pack has a total of 60 songs!! Mostly of the songs from the third cd is from "Voodoo Lounge". It says Sony Music Records - Hong Kong / Maylaisia. It's from 2003. It's for sure not official, but a very nice release indeed!!
